The CURA Book (Research Group on Culture, Urbanism, Resistance and Architecture), organised by professor and researcher André Carvalho, seeks to reflect on and present the relationships between architecture, art and design, based on the research being carried out. To this end, as well as presenting the exhibition Atravessar e Presente (Crossing and Present), which brings together works by artists who situate the idea of the city in the contemporary debate on social emergencies and their relationship with art, the book also includes texts by CURA researchers dealing with poetics and themes linked to their respective research: the city, gender, social design, graphic expression and life. The book also brings together texts and translations by guest researchers on themes that are very dear to CURA's vocation and that emphasise the relationship between architecture and design in relation to territoriality, ethnicity, art and history.
